Transaction 511307840dcf4532d8830de01fc8ef59cbf74d59d73a660f4951b5a43cca1ffd

1 Input
2 Outputs
  • 511307840dcf4532d8830de01fc8ef59cbf74d59d73a660f4951b5a43cca1ffd:0
  • value  71561
    address  3H5QL3knpxUmnfEiQyfpM7gHTzHK1N2y6r
  • 511307840dcf4532d8830de01fc8ef59cbf74d59d73a660f4951b5a43cca1ffd:1
  • value  18271943
    address  36RfYZ4fYT3snysxqBJK3Uz68Q2N8XhwT2